Maungaharuru-Tangitū new General Manager announced

Maungaharuru-Tangitū Trust today announces Lee Grace (Ngāti Porou, Ngāi Tahu, Niuean, Irish and English) as their new Kaiwhakahaere Matua – General Manager.

“We are pleased to welcome Lee as our new General Manager of the Maungaharuru-Tangitū Trust.  Lee brings more than 20 years experience as a chartered accountant, with qualifications in both accountancy and commercial law and experience in managing Māori businesses.  Lee also brings a passion for realising whānau aspirations and our region,” says Shane Taurima, Chairperson of Maungaharuru-Tangitū Trust.  

“Lee spent his childhood and schooling years close to Tangoio, in the Eskdale valley. He is ideally placed to continue the great mahi of the past, and to continue to progress our hapū aspirations,” says Shane.

Maungaharuru-Tangitū Trust, based in the Hawke’s Bay represents the hapū of Marangatūhetaua (Ngāti Tū), Ngāti Kurumōkihi, Ngāti Whakaari, Ngāi Tauira, Ngāi Te Ruruku ki Tangoio, and Ngāi Tahu. 

“I am excited by the role and by Maungaharuru-Tangitū Trust’s strategic direction and priorities.  It is exactly the type of work I enjoy leading and being a part of.  I am looking forward to implementing the mahi that reflects the aspirations of whānau and hapū of Maungaharuru-Tangitū,” says Lee.

Lee has a passion for healthy lifestyles, whānau and community. He is a trustee of Te Rangihaeata Oranga Trust and until recently, Rugby League Hawke’s Bay. He helped set up well known community events, ‘Kai in the Bay’, ‘Battle for Life’ and IronMāori and has been a trustee for Te Aranga o Heretaunga marae since 2012. 

The pōwhiri to formally welcome Lee and his whānau – wife, Dr Kiriana Bird and children Tyler and Ariana, is at 10am, on Saturday, 26 June 2021 at Tangoio Marae.  Everyone is welcome.
